In a chilling case out of Waukegan, Illinois, a 52-year-old Mexican national, Jose Luis Mendoza-Gonzalez, charged in the gruesome death of 37-year-old Megan Bos, was rearrested by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) agents in Chicago on a recent Saturday after an earlier release by a local judge sparked outrage.

Breitbart reported that Megan Bos vanished in February, and her family reported her missing by early March. Her fate remained a mystery until police made a horrifying discovery: her body, decapitated, stuffed into a container filled with bleach in Mendoza-Gonzalez’s yard. From Discovery to Initial Arrest

Authorities first arrested Mendoza-Gonzalez in April, charging him with concealing a corpse, abusing a corpse, and obstructing justice. The evidence was damning, yet the story took a bewildering turn.

Lake County Judge Randie Bruno made the controversial decision to release Mendoza-Gonzalez after that initial arrest.
